109 Hillside Road, Bramcote, Nottingham, NG9 3SU is a freehold detached property built between 1967-1975. The property offers approximately 1,604 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have five b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£519,818 , which equates to approximately £324 per square foot. It was last sold on 8 Aug 2024 for £510,000. Since then, the value has increased by £9,818, representing a 1.9% increase, or approximately 1.4% per year.

109 Hillside Road, Bramcote, Nottingham, Broxtowe, Nottinghamshire, NG9 3SU has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 11 Mar 2020.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 21 Nov 2008. The rating of D rem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 12.5%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 100 mm loft insulation to pitched, 150 mm loft insulation, improving energy efficiency from average to good.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, partial insulation (assumed) to cavity wall, as built, no insulation (assumed), changing energy efficiency from average to poor.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 10%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 71%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from poor to very good.
